**Ticket DD-341: Signature check failing on Alertmuffle deploy**

The Alertmuffle deduplicator build failed its signature verification in staging last night. For newer folks: every artifact is checked against the release key before rollout, and a mismatch blocks the deploy. This one mismatched because the key rotated last week. The correct current key is below.

release key, yagap-kagag: bky6_1ks93y

### Step 4: Deploy the History Service

Before approving, confirm that the Sketchloom undo/redo history service passes the replay suite — every undo must restore exact node positions, and redo stacks must survive a restart. Once the reviewer checklist is green, the artifact is packaged and must be signed prior to upload. Sign it with the key shown below.

rollout seal: bky4_x7Gc

MEMO — Kettling Depot Receiving

Uniform sets for the new Kettling depot arrive Wednesday via Ashgrove courier: 40 boxes, sorted by size, manifest attached to box one. Check the count at the dock before signing; shortages go straight to stores, not the courier. The hand-over instruction the courier will follow is set out below.

drop instructions, tafof-baguf: the holmir gilox courier leaves the sormir ulaok holdor ledger at gate 5596 under passcode 257343

# Env file — Cartwheel dispatch, driver-assignment heuristic
# Scope: staging only. Do not promote to prod.
# The heuristic weights (proximity, shift balance, refusal rate) are tuned
# for the Velmont pilot region and will misbehave elsewhere.
# Review notes: heuristic service runs unprivileged; it reads weights
# read-only from the tuning store and writes nothing back.
# Only one sensitive value exists in this file: the tuning-store access
# credential, consumed at boot and never logged.
# That credential is set on the following line.

secret setting of faduf-bahop: LEDGER_TOKEN8=c3b363be

Subject: Autoscaler ownership change

All,

Effective Monday, responsibility for the Brindlecore queue-depth autoscaler moves off my plate. Plugin authors: the scaling hooks API is unchanged. Depth thresholds, cooldown tuning, and review of scaling-policy plugins now route to the new owner. Pending PRs will be re-triaged this week; expect some delay. Do not merge anything touching the drain logic until the handover completes. For all autoscaler matters going forward, contact the engineer named below.

account owner for bawip-tahag: Raleth Quenok